Dermaplaning has exploded in popularity over the past few years, and for good reason. But with popularity comes misinformation. As a licensed esthetician in Roseville, I want to set the record straight on some common dermaplaning myths.

Myth #1: Hair Will Grow Back Thicker and Darker

The Truth: This is the most common concern I hear from clients in Roseville and Rocklin. Dermaplaning removes vellus hair (peach fuzz), which is genetically programmed to grow back at the same texture and color. The hair may feel slightly different as it grows back because the tip is blunt from being cut, but it will taper naturally just as before.

Myth #2: Dermaplaning Causes Breakouts

The Truth: When performed correctly by a licensed professional, dermaplaning should not cause breakouts. In fact, by removing dead skin cells and debris, it often helps prevent breakouts. If you experience breakouts after dermaplaning, it may be due to the products used afterward or an underlying skin condition that should be addressed.

Myth #3: Dermaplaning is Painful

The Truth: Most clients find dermaplaning to be relaxing! The treatment involves gentle, feather-like strokes with a sterile surgical blade. Many of my Granite Bay and Folsom clients describe it as a light scratching sensation and often fall asleep during the treatment.

Myth #4: Anyone Can Do Dermaplaning at Home

The Truth: While at-home dermaplaning tools exist, professional treatments are safer and more effective. Licensed estheticians are trained in proper technique, sanitation, and can assess whether dermaplaning is appropriate for your skin type and current conditions.

Who is a Good Candidate for Dermaplaning?

Dermaplaning is excellent for most skin types, particularly those who want:

  • Smoother makeup application
  • Brighter, more radiant skin
  • Better product penetration
  • A gentle exfoliation option

Who Should Avoid Dermaplaning?

Those with active acne, rosacea flares, or very sensitive skin may want to consider other treatments. During your consultation at our Roseville studio, I'll assess your skin and recommend the best treatment plan for your goals.
